Dewetting can be greatly suppressed in high molecular weight (entangled) or glassy polymer films (T &lt; T g) spun-cast from solution. It is difficult for these films to equilibrate so that surface energetics is less of a factor governing surface wetting. A shortcoming of this approach is that dewetting still tends to occur,

WebJan 20, 2004 · Energetic considerations indicate that long-range Van der Waals forces stabilize thin polystyrene (PS) films against height fluctuations on silicon substrates. Nevertheless, we report here on the amplification of capillary waves of specific wavelengths for 15 nm thick PS films on silicon, ultimately leading to dewetting in a “spinodal-like” …
